Can vinegar ruin your grout?

Can vinegar ruin your grout? Vinegar can indeed ruin grout. Unfortunately, vinegar penetrates unsealed grout by seeping into the air spaces within the material. Once lodged in these spaces, vinegar will corrode grout with the passage of time. The grout will eventually wear off.

What is the best way to clear a clogged kitchen sink?

What is the best way to clear a clogged kitchen sink? Pour one cup of fresh baking soda down the drain, followed by one cup of white vinegar. Place a rubber stopper or other sink hole cover over the drain opening. Wait 15 minutes to allow the vinegar and baking soda to unclog your drain, Then take out the drain cover and run hot tap water down the drain to clear the clog.

How do you get cat pee out of fabric?

How do you get cat pee out of fabric? Use your washing machine to wash the stained clothes, preferably with an enzyme detergent. Afterwards, air dry your clothes. Some recommend adding one pound of baking soda to the wash or to run a cycle with a cup of white vinegar and no detergent, then run a second cycle with regular detergent. Try again.

How much does Stanley steemer charge for grout cleaning?

How much does Stanley steemer charge for grout cleaning? For an average kitchen of 300 square feet, cleaning a tile floor and grout costs $300-$900. Stanley Steemer[1] charges $0.75-$1 per square foot depending on geographic location of the customer.

How do you clean white sheets with peroxide?

How do you clean white sheets with peroxide? You can use hydrogen peroxide to whiten and brighten clothes, disinfect laundry, and remove stains. Pour it directly on stains such as blood. Add 1 cup of hydrogen peroxide to whites in the washing machine to brighten them.
